Hospital Inpatient Detoxification - Drug and Alcohol Treatment Facilities - Sanford, NC.

Detoxification is the first step of getting off of drugs and alcohol, and you might make the decision to go through detoxification in a hospital inpatient detox center for a few reasons. Hospital inpatient detoxification in Sanford provides medically managed detox, which is performed with the help of nurses and physicians who can make detox more comfortable, using medications to ease symptoms and make detox safer. A person detoxing from alcohol for example might benefit from particular medications during detox to prevent seizures and tremors that are common during serious alcohol withdrawal. An individual who is experiencing heroin or prescription opioid withdrawal might choose to take part in medical detox in a hospital inpatient facility, where medications are utilized to ease them through a very uncomfortable (but typically not life threatening) type of withdrawal. People in a hospital inpatient detox facility remain at the facility until the symptoms of withdrawal have gone away. This could be anywhere from 1 to 2 weeks depending on what drug they are detoxing from and their overall physical and mental health.

For an individual who has been struggling with drug and alcohol addiction for some time, there would ideally be an immediate and smooth transition from a hospital inpatient detoxification facility to a drug and/or alcohol recovery program to handle their addiction due to the fact that detox is not treatment in itself.
